> Seeing the hype online feels both validating and deeply frustrating.

The post is conflating hype and money with technical innovation, they are not really correlated. Kurzweil is known for saying most innovations succeed based not on technology but on timing. Today, who talks about it might matter even more than timing.

Superior research often gets overlooked in favor of someone raising millions, sometimes people who have produced literally nothing manage to sell it. Not saying that's happening here, but I've seen this pattern a lot over my career.

Someone riding (or manufacturing) a hype wave is playing a completely different game from a researcher. If you're a researcher you can't really feel dejected when someone is making a business on the back of what seems like your research; legal protections are decades out of date, even ignoring vibe coding. If you want to make money/hype/whatever off of your work, do that. But realize that it's a path that's often orthogonal to research.
